剑指offer:15 反转链表

2019-08-08  本文已影响0人  毛毛毛毛毛豆

题目描述

输入一个链表,反转链表后,输出新链表的表头。

Python

class Solution:

    # 返回ListNode

    def ReverseList(self, pHead):

        # write code here

        if pHead is None:

            return None

        pre = None

        while pHead.next:

            tmp = pHead.next

            pHead.next = pre

            pre = pHead

            pHead = tmp

        pHead.next = pre

        return pHead

上一篇 下一篇

猜你喜欢

热点阅读